Marinerong Pilipino-San Beda, CEU dispute last finals berth

Marinerong Pilipino-San Beda and Centro Escolar University battle one more time to dispute the last finals ticket in the 2024 PBA D-League Aspirants' Cup on Thursday at the Ynares Sports Arena in Pasig.

Game time is 7:30 p.m. with the survivor earning the right to challenge two-time defending champion EcoOil-La Salle in another best-of-three series for the championship.

CEU won Game 1, 75-71, but San Beda staved off elimination by dominating Game 2, 84-76, to level the series and forced sudden death.

The Red Lions will be coming in with the psychological advantage, but the Scorpions are unperturbed considering they have beaten their rival two straight.

"Laban lang," said San Beda mentor Yuri Escueta, claiming his Red Lions are not the heavy favorite in Game 3 despite their being the NCAA champions.

"Wala kaming 7-footer at Class A na import," noted Escueta referring to Abdul-Wahab Olusesi.

"Of course, they have good locals also and they're well-coached. Hindi na nakakagulat na championship team sila."

Behind the efforts of Yukien Andrada, Joe Celzo and Jomel Puno, San Beda did a good job neutralizing Olusesi in Game 2. Olusesi managed just nine points in 34 minutes of play although he grabbed 13 rebounds and had three blocks.

"Our mantra is to just play better and smarter than the past two games we played," added Escueta, who is also counting on Bryan Sajonia, James Payosing, Nygel Gonzales and Emmanuel Tagle.

The Scorpions are just as determined.

"We expected that San Beda would be a different team come playoff time. We must dig in more and believe that we still can do this," said CEU coach Jeff Perlas, keeping his fingers crossed that Franz Ray Diaz, Daniel Marcelo and Jerome Santos will once again rise to the occasion. (JBU)
